2016-06-01 40 views
-1

フォーム全体の内容をエコーするために私のウェブサイトにスクリプトを作成しています。私のhtmlコードは次のようになります。投稿フォームphy

<form action ="forma.php" method ="POST" name="FORM-TXT"> 
 
    First name:<br> 
 
    <input type="text" name="firstname"><br> 
 
    Last name:<br> 
 
    <input type="text" name="lastname"> 
 
      <input type="submit" name="submitsave" value ="Submit"> 
 
</form>
私のPHPコードは次のようになります。

<?php 
error_reporting(E_ALL); 
ini_set('display_errors', 1); 
//use the html Name element to attach html to php scripts 
//V-----------------=|txt file codes|=-----------------V 
$text = $_POST["FORM-TXT"]; 
echo $text; 
?> 

私は、フォームを実行すると、このエラーがスローされます。

お知らせ:未定義のインデックス:FORM-TXT in /homepages/31/d585123241/htdocs/mail/forma.php on line 7

どのようにフォーム全体をエコーすることができますか?特定の要素は参照されません。フォームのみが参照されます。 @EatPeanutButter同様

+1

フォーム全体を渡すことはできません。あなたの$ _POSTを 'var_dump 'すると、どのキーと値の組が実際に渡されるかを知ることができます。 – WillardSolutions

+1

$ _POSTには、「」、「